We are now recruiting a Sales Manager to join Klättermusen.

Since 1975 Klättermusen has been a pioneer in making refined Scandinavian Mountaineering Equipment. The designs combine utility and extreme durability, always with consideration of the environment in mind. Klättermusen supports and inspire outdoor enthusiasts through unforgiving weather conditions and unpredictable terrains. Rigorously tested in real-world conditions, the equipment embodies Klättermusen’s commitment to creating the best and most sustainable equipment available.

We are currently looking to hire a full time Sales Manager for the UK. The roles main tasks will be sales, customer service and support.

This person will play an important role within the UK for Klättermusen. The role will work closely with the Head of Sales Europe and the global sales team.
